Abstract

The utility model discloses an intelligent gas meter based on a switch reluctance sensor. The intelligent gas meter comprises a basic gas meter, a signal acquirer and a controller. A front counter of the basic gas meter comprises a counter support and a plurality of counter type drums. The signal acquirer comprises a switch reluctance sensor, a signal receiving board and a magnet. The switch reluctance sensor is welded on the signal receiving board which is fixed on the upper surface of the counter support. The magnet is embedded on one of the counter type drums. The controller is disposed below the counter inside the basic gas meter and is connected with the signal receiving board through a wire. A power module and an LCD (Liquid crystal display) are respectively connected with the controller. The signal reading function is realized by replacing the original reed sensor with the switch reluctance sensor, and the intelligent gas meter is accurate in metering, convenient to install, highly sensitive and high in metering precision.

Technical field
The utility model relates to a kind of flow measurement device, specifically a kind of intelligent gas meter based on the switching magnetic-resistance sensor.
Background technology
The at present existing intelligent gas meter mode of winning the confidence mainly adopts and add a circuit board above counter, weld tongue tube on circuit board, or on the counter-support above counter directly fixedly tongue tube as sensor, fixed magnets on character wheel of counter, obtain flow signal to coordinate sensor simultaneously.Because tongue tube is glass material, when reaching fixedly, welding very easily causes damage, simultaneously move or transportation in also can cause damage, cause to obtain the counter pulse signal, or can not Obtaining Accurate counter pulse signal, cause intelligent gas meter not measure or measure inaccurately, simultaneously the tongue tube volume is difficult for greatly installing.
The utility model content
For above-mentioned deficiency, the utility model provides a kind of intelligent gas meter based on the switching magnetic-resistance sensor, and it is accurate measurement, easy for installation not only, and highly sensitive, and measuring accuracy is high.
